Iver station is well-equipped to assist passengers with accessibility needs, offering step-free access throughout, ramps for train access, and accessible ticket machines located in the ticket hall. This makes traveling easy and convenient for everyone. You can collect your pre-purchased tickets from the machine available at the station, ensuring you can grab your tickets hassle-free. Plan your journey in advance and remember that staff are on hand to provide assistance through designated help points and at the ticket office.
The station features essential amenities to ensure a comfortable wait for your train. Whilst there are no dedicated waiting room offices, seating areas with multiple uncovered seats are available on platforms 3 and 4. Toilets, including accessible ones, are located conveniently in the ticket hall, keeping all the necessities close to hand. However, do note that there are no refreshment facilities or shops, so planning ahead on snacks and drinks is advised.
For those looking to explore further or connect to other transport, Iver station is a brilliant hub. To reach Heathrow Airport, simply take the Elizabeth Line and change at Hayes & Harlington. Alternatively, head over to West Drayton Station for a 350 bus connection. During any rail disruption, the station offers a rail replacement service departing from Bathurst Walk near the station’s entrance.

Portslade Station offers an array of fac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. The ticket office is open Monday through Saturday from 05:55 to 19:20, and on Sunday from 08:10 to 15:45.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available, including those that are accessible, offering the convenience of online ticket collection. Induction loops are in place to support travelers with hearing difficulties, ensuring clarity when purchasing tickets or querying about your journey.
While step-free access is available to both platforms of Portslade, it does involve using separate entrances and steep ramps. If you require assistance, station staff are typically available from early morning until late at night, offering help on a 'turn up and go' basis. There are no waiting rooms, but seating areas are provided to ensure comfort while waiting for trains. Ensuring safe travel for everyone, the station also offers a staff-operated ramp for easy access between the platform and train.
Whether you're transitioning from train to bus or taxi, Portslade Station provides well-defined connections. A taxi rank is conveniently located adjacent to the entrance of platform 1. While specific bus information is present on the 'Onward Travel Information Map' at the station, rest assured that various local services are available to extend your journey beyond the train.
